Modi, others greet Indian team on Kabaddi World Cup win

IANS

New Delhi, Oct 22 (IANS) Prime Minister Narendra Modi and other political leaders on Saturday congratulated the Indian team for winning the Kabaddi World Cup after defeating Iran.

"Congratulations to the Indian team for winning the Kabaddi World Cup. The team showed exceptional skills, grit and determination. Well done!," Modi tweeted.

India fought off a tough challenge from Iran to win their third successive Kabaddi World Cup.

In perhaps the most exciting match of this World Cup, the Indians overturned a first-half deficit with a superb second-half performance to win 38-29.

Bharatiya Janata Party (BJP) leaders including Union Home Minister Rajnath Singh, Minister of Finance and Corporate Affairs Arun Jaitley, Minister of Agriculture and Farmers Welfare Radha Mohan Singh, Minister of State Skill Development and Entrepreneurship (Independent Charge) Rajiv Pratap Rudy and Union Minister of Steel Birender Singh also congratulated team India through their Twitter accounts.

Besides, Indian National Congress (INC) also greeted Indian Kabaddi team.

"Congratulations Team India on winning the Kabaddi World Cup," Indian National Congress (INC) tweeted.
